Sabrina talks with naturopathic doctor and Menopause Society Certified Practitioner, Ashley Chauvin about what perimenopause really is, why symptoms can hit long before menopause, and why “normal” lab results don’t always match how you feel. We share practical ways to advocate for yourself, support mood and sleep, and build a sustainable plan that fits real life.
• defining menopause vs perimenopause and why timing varies
• common perimenopause symptoms including temperature dysregulation, sleep changes, mood shifts, vaginal and urinary changes, body composition changes
• why hormone testing can be unreliable during perimenopause and what matters more than a single snapshot
• rule-outs that can mimic symptoms, especially thyroid dysfunction and nutrient deficiencies
• mood support through iron, B12, vitamin D, nutrition, sleep and realistic movement
• when hormone therapy or other medications can help support lifestyle changes
• prevention mindset for cholesterol, blood pressure and long-term health
• making a plan sustainable through travel, stress and real-world routines
• building a circle of care with therapists and medical specialists
• how to spot medical misinformation especially in social media and push for better conversations
